GNOME Bugzilla – Bug 468129
[basertpaudiopayload] event handler returns the wrong value
Last modified: 2007-09-05 15:56:39 UTC
The event handler in GstBaseRTPAudioPayload returns TRUE stopping events, but it should return FALSE so that the default handler is called.
Created attachment 93926 [details] [review] simple patch to return false instead of true
*** Bug 469322 has been marked as a duplicate of this bug. ***
This has been fixed now, it seems, thanks! 2007-09-04 Wim Taymans <wim.taymans@gmail.com> * gst-libs/gst/rtp/gstbasertpaudiopayload.c: (gst_base_rtp_payload_audio_handle_event): Return FALSE from the event handler to let the parent class handle the event. * gst-libs/gst/rtp/gstbasertpdepayload.c: (gst_base_rtp_depayload_chain), (gst_base_rtp_depayload_push_full): Mark outgoing buffers as DISCONT if the incomming buffer was DISCONT. * gst-libs/gst/rtp/gstbasertppayload.c: Bump the MTU to 1400.